    Posted by Dave Edwards on July 20, 2014 at 12:49 pm

    One of my customers – with a recent BluRay player – cannot read the BluRay disc I burned for him. I checked the build and sent a fresh copy with the same result. The disc works on my three computer-based BluRay players and my domestic Panasonic player as well as on that of another customer (where I used the disc for demo purposes).

    Can anyone suggest anything to look at? I was thinking of asking him to try to run a firmware upgrade on his player, though if it’s recent.. He claims he’s been unable to play the disc on two other players so I’m rather baffled.

    I should say that I’ve had no complaints from other customers.

    Hey Dave,
    I double-check my authoring-work…

    sometimes sony vs panasonic interpreting IG-graphics in a different way, so you need to have a look for some of the IG-commands agian to take care they would work on both of them.

    that´s what I do…

    what kind of BD did you create? BD25 or BD50? I know a few older players, that doesn´t like both – only replicated ones.

    I also had a brand new panasonic BD3D-player that doesn´t exept BD-R/BD-RE after 3 month. appears to be a laser-problem within some players…. 🙁
